Journey to Freedom is the fourth studio album by American recording artist Michelle Williams, released on September 9, 2014, by E1 Music and Light Records. It marked her first release under the label after severing professional ties with longtime record company Columbia Records and manager Mathew Knowles in 2009.

Sep 9, 2014 · Her fourth solo release, Journey to Freedom, returns her to sanctified realms with a batch of uplifting tunes that combine scripture-rooted lyrics with sparkling, inventive arrangements. Williams’ singing style avoids diva grandstanding in favor of a more natural approach, infusing her testimonies with gratitude and compassion.
Williams’ evokes a raw passion on “Free,” conveying the struggles of breaking life’s chains that can bind: “How did I get here?/Where did I lose it?” This Journey to Freedom is by far Williams’ best body of work, a personal cleansing that further amplifies her dexterity with multiple genres.
